Girl Scout Troop 6343. Thursday, March 31, 2011. On March 7, the Girl Scout cookies arrived. The troop as a whole sold 147 cases of cookies, including 10 cases of Operation Cookie Share. That's a lot of cases to be picked up, sorted and delivered. The top selling cookie for the troop was the Caramel DeLites. Cases of cookies waiting to be sorted. Sunday, July 17, 2011. In May, Anneliese was invited to represent the Junior Girl Scouts at the wreath laying ceremony at Lincoln's Tomb as part of the annual Boy Scouts Lincoln Pilgrimage. Lincoln's Pilgrimage is a Boy Scout tradition whereby the Boy Scouts hike from Lincoln's New Salem to Springfield. The Girl Scouts are invited to participate in the wreath laying ceremony. Sunday, July 17, 2011. While visiting the Alabama coast we took a day trip to Dauphin Island, a barrier island in the mouth of the Mobile Bay. We accessed the island via a short ferry ride from Fort Morgan. It was interesting to see all the natural gas platforms in the Bay. While on Dauphin Island we enjoyed visiting historic Fort Gaines, the Audobon bird sanctuary, and the Sea Lab Estuarium. Subscribe to: Post Comments (Atom). A picture says a thousand words.
